🏠 Buyer Tips

Short sale purchases require patience and flexibility. Get pre-approved financing early, as many lenders require proof of funds. Hire an experienced short sale agent familiar with Laguna Hills' community rules and lender preferences. Include contingencies for appraisal gaps and lender approval. Inspect thoroughly before making offers, as properties may need updating. Expect negotiations with both sellers and banks, and avoid emotional attachments to timelines.

🔑 Seller Tips

List short sale properties competitively with realistic pricing to encourage offers quickly. Gather complete financial documentation upfront to expedite lender review. Communicate transparently with buyers about timelines and approval uncertainty. Work with lenders familiar with Laguna Hills transactions. Consider hiring a short sale specialist to manage bank negotiations. Document all communications and maintain organized files for smooth processing.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is a short sale and how does it work in Laguna Hills? +
A short sale occurs when a lender approves the sale of a home for less than the mortgage balance owed. The bank forgives the difference. In Laguna Hills, this process typically takes 6-12 months and requires lender approval at every stage. Both buyer and seller must work together through negotiations while the bank reviews the transaction.
How long does a Laguna Hills short sale typically take to close? +
Laguna Hills short sales generally take 6-12 months from offer acceptance to closing. Timeline depends on lender response speed, appraisal completion, and approval processes. Recent market improvements have shortened some timelines to 4-6 months. Complex financial situations may extend negotiations beyond 12 months, requiring patience from all parties.
Are there tax implications for Laguna Hills short sale buyers? +
Buyers generally face minimal tax consequences. Sellers may owe taxes on forgiven debt under the Mortgage Forgiveness Debt Relief Act, though exceptions exist. Consult a tax professional regarding your specific situation, as federal and California tax laws can affect short sale transactions differently based on individual circumstances and property details.
